Overview
- Minaj told Katie Miller, “No, I don’t think we landed on the moon,” during a discussion about conspiracy theories.
- Katie Miller raised topics including chemtrails and noted Elon Musk told her the U.S. did land on the moon, a point Minaj dismissed with a shrug.
- The full episode was released on February 3 across major platforms, placing the comment at the forefront of current coverage.
- Minaj’s interview follows her January 28 appearance at the Trump Accounts Summit in Washington, where she stood with President Trump, called herself his No. 1 fan, and pledged a personal contribution in the hundreds of thousands of dollars.
- Her recent political alignment and new comments have prompted backlash, including a joke from Grammys host Trevor Noah referencing her absence and ties to Trump.
